Julia Language December 2024 Community Update: Compiler Optimizations and Ecosystem Growth
The December 2024 edition of 'This Month in Julia World' highlights significant technical advancements and community developments within the Julia programming language ecosystem. Key internal improvements include a major overhaul of escape analysis to enhance memory optimization and near-complete support for the MMTk garbage collector framework. Discussions on interfaces, traits, and performance optimizations like @inbounds were also prominent. The newsletter calls for contributors, highlighting funded opportunities with the Center for Quantum Networks and SciML, alongside a search for a new maintainer for ChainRules. Ecosystem updates feature new registry requirements for release notes, tools like DispatchDoctor.jl for type stability, and enhanced benchmarking capabilities in Chairmarks.jl. Notably, Julia's application in signal processing and satellite control is gaining traction. The autodiff sector sees progress with DynamicDiff.jl and improved documentation for DifferentiationInterface.jl. Cross-ecosystem notes mention philosophical parallels between Julia and Emacs, as well as NumPy's performance gains via AVX-512. This digest serves as a comprehensive overview of technical progress, maintenance needs, and emerging use cases for developers and researchers engaged with the Julia community.
